Connells Estate Agents are delighted to present this beautifully maintained two-bedroom family home, ideally situated on the highly sought-after Woods Estate in Wednesbury.

This stylish and spacious property offers well-presented accommodation throughout and is perfectly suited to first-time buyers, young families, or those looking to down size.

The ground floor briefly comprises a generous lounge with ample space for both living and dining, finished to a high standard with tasteful decor throughout. The modern fitted kitchen offers a range of wall and base units, plumbing for utilities, space for appliances, and direct access to the rear garden.

To the first floor are two surprisingly spacious double bedrooms and a newly fitted contemporary family bathroom featuring elegant tiling and quality fixtures.

Externally, the property truly stands out. The beautifully landscaped rear garden has been thoughtfully designed for both relaxation and entertaining, featuring a patio seating area, a useful brick-built storage room, dedicated play area, additional seating space, and a versatile summer house. The summer house benefits from electricity and is currently arranged with storage to one side and a stylish entertainment/lounge area to the other, including space for a wall-mounted television.

To the front of the property is ample off-road parking, along with secure side access via double gates providing convenient entry to the rear garden.
